HC Deb 07 June 2004 vol 422 c38
Mr. Tam Dalyell (Linlithgow) (Lab)

On a point of order, Mr. Speaker. May I appeal to your theological erudition and ask whether "Jonah" is a proper parliamentary term? While you are thinking of the answer, Mr. Speaker, may I point out to my right hon. Friend the Member for Carrick, Cumnock and Doon Valley (Mr. Foulkes) that, under the previous Saddam regime, there were, for all its faults, substantially more women in the Iraqi Parliament than in the House of Commons?

Mr. Speaker

May I tell the Father of the House that I leave my theology to the Speaker's Chaplain?
